What Is The Red Tea Detox Recipe and What are the Benefits of This Tea
Rooibos tea is among the teas that are used medicinally and have many benefits, and weight loss is among those benefits.
This tea, which has become popular with its natural sweetness, unique color and excellent taste, is also known for being caffeine-free and full of antioxidants, protecting the heart, liver, and brain against cancer.
- The plant has been used as a medicine for hundreds of years and has recently gained popularity as a daily consumed drink due to various studies.
- The unique feature of this tea is that it does not contain caffeine. When you want to drink a decaffeinated beverage, you can consume rooibos tea.
- Rooibos flower is a shrub plant that grows in South Africa. It is commonly dried and used as a red detox tea.
- There is no tannin in it. Tannin is a substance that reduces iron absorption and is not present in this tea.
- Rooibos in tea form has been consumed for at least 300 years.

Ingredients
- 1 teaspoon of rooibos tea
- 1 cup of hot water
Instructions
To brew rooibos tea at home, you need dry rooibos tea leaves.
Add 1 teaspoon of dried rooibos tea to 1 cup of hot water and let it brew for 3 minutes with the lid closed.
Then, you can filter the tea and consume it fresh.
You can drink the tea hot or cold. You can benefit from this tea by adding ice to your glass on hot summer days.
